In the Makefile of www/caddy-custom, the version of the paket is tracked fr=
om
www/caddy.

Yet, xcaddy is not explicitely told to build the same specific version, so =
it
will always build latest.

At least it does so in the build environment I have to use.

This makes it hard to maintain a reproducible build since it can change from
one day to the other when a new caddy version releases, like right now with
version 2.8.1.

References:

https://github.com/caddyserver/xcaddy?tab=3Dreadme-ov-file#examples

I have patched it here with a quick patch:

https://github.com/opnsense/ports/commit/58e93c8775ffddd9b1720d612d2744620f=
0a779d
